Amentum, a large government contract company, is seeking a **Safety Manager** to support the WEXMAC Camp Bliss contract in El Paso, TX. **POSITION SUMMARY** Responsible for the management and administration of safety field operations and programs to ensure a safe and compliant work environment to include modification of safety-related activities and plans to specific contracts in compliance with federal, state and local regulatory requirements. Rely on extensive experience and judgment to plan and accomplish goals. + Develop and maintain applicable safety and health procedures and practices in compliance with corporate, state, federal and local regulations and contract requirements. + Promote the implementation of occupational safety programs, procedures and activities. + Promote the current OSHA compliant culture throughout the organization. + Facilitate safety process development, implementation, and compliance of all subcontracts. + Manage safety audit program for field and construction locations to ensure compliance with various contractual, regulatory and company requirements. + Participate and support integration at the site level to address site-related safety, quality, health and welfare to include environmental concerns. + Provide guidance to managers and supervisors to assist in the interpretation and compliance of safety and health-related contract requirements. + Coordinate field investigations for injury, property damage and vehicle incidents to ensure thorough investigations and appropriate root cause identification. + Conduct special evaluations and internal safety and health field surveys/audits. + Compile reports and findings of surveys and audits for review and makes corrective action recommendations and tracks to closure as required. + Manage field and construction safety operations. **QUALIFICATIONS** + Eight (8) years’ progressively responsible experience in any combination within program management, plant & operations management, or safety & environmental compliance. + Two (2) years management experience preferred. + Advanced knowledge of EHS policies and processes. + Working knowledge of compliance with Hazardous Material (HAZMAT) handling. + Excellent oral and written communications skills. + Project planning and management skills. + Ability to get results through influence, negotiation and teamwork. + Proven leadership ability. + Working knowledge of quality management, its concepts, techniques, tools and procedures. + Must be able to obtain and maintain facility credentials/authorization. Note: US Citizenship is required for facility credentials/authorization at this work location. **EDUCATION** Bachelor’s degree in in industrial hygiene, environmental, health and safety management or other associated discipline preferred; two (2) years of experience in related field may be substituted for each year of the four (4) years of college. **WORKING AND LIVING CONDITIONS** This position may be located in an environment with harsh and dangerous working and living conditions.
